Just installed a Pioneer A08XL and archived 2 DVD's the first was to a Verbatim +R DL rated at x2.4 according to nero this was burnt at x4 the next was to a TDK (ricohjpn r02) rated at x8 the burn took place at x12

I'm using the version 1.10 firmware on the drive my A07 would only every burn at the rated speed of the disk so if the A08 is burning by some other means I'm impressed.

Yes both disks are without errors and given the actual burn time I'd say nero was reporting the correct speeds. =D>

you can have nero report your burn speed in real time if you like, just change nero settings in the registry

make a new notepad document then just paste this text into it:

REGEDIT4

[H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Ahead\Nero - Burning Rom\Recorder]
"ShowSingleRecorderSpeed"=dword:00000001

then save it as something like showspeed.reg, save then double click and click yes to add it to your registery

restart computer then reburn again to show real speed
